Sharpening Your Mind: A Comprehensive Guide to Building Chess Problem Solving Skills
Chess, often described as a microcosm of life, demands strategic thinking, meticulous planning, and the ability to anticipate your opponent's moves. A crucial aspect of mastering this ancient game lies in the ability to solve chess problems, also known as chess puzzles. These problems present specific positions where you must find the best sequence of moves to achieve a desired outcome, such as checkmate, a material advantage, or a forced draw. Whether you are a beginner or an experienced player, honing your chess problem-solving skills will significantly enhance your overall game.

Essential Techniques for Solving Chess Problems
To effectively tackle chess problems, it's essential to approach them with a systematic and structured methodology. Here are some key techniques to keep in mind:
1. Analyze the Position Carefully
Before making any moves, take the time to thoroughly assess the position. Consider the following factors:
- Material Balance: Are you ahead or behind in material? If so, how does this influence your options?
- King Safety: How secure are both kings? Are there any immediate threats or vulnerabilities?
- Piece Activity: Which pieces are active and which are passive? Are there any pieces that are poorly placed or restricted in their movement?
- Pawn Structure: What are the strengths and weaknesses of the pawn structure? Are there any passed pawns or pawn breaks that could be exploited?
- Control of Key Squares: Who controls the important squares in the center and on the flanks?
2. Identify Candidate Moves
Based on your analysis of the position, identify a few candidate moves that seem promising. These are the moves that you will investigate more deeply. Some common candidate moves include:
- Checks: Forced moves that can disrupt the opponent's plans and potentially lead to a quick victory.
- Captures: Taking pieces can lead to material advantages and weaken the opponent's position.
- Threats: Creating immediate threats can force the opponent to react defensively and potentially open up new opportunities.
- Forcing Moves: Moves that restrict the opponent's options and force them to respond in a certain way.
3. Calculate Variations
Once you have identified your candidate moves, carefully calculate the variations that follow each move. Try to anticipate your opponent's responses and think several moves ahead. Visualize the resulting positions and evaluate their pros and cons.

4. Look for Forcing Sequences
When calculating variations, prioritize forcing sequences, such as checks, captures, and threats. These sequences are more likely to lead to a clear solution than passive moves.
Example: A forcing sequence might involve a series of sacrifices that lead to a checkmate. Or it might involve winning a pawn but opening lines for an attack.
5. Consider All Possible Defenses
It's not enough to find a promising line of attack; you must also consider all possible defenses that your opponent might employ. Try to anticipate their best responses and see if you can overcome them.
Example: If you are planning a knight fork, make sure your opponent doesn't have a way to interpose a piece or move their king to safety.
6. Evaluate the Resulting Position
After calculating a variation, carefully evaluate the resulting position. Is it better or worse than the starting position? Does it lead to a clear advantage or a draw? If the resulting position is unclear, try to calculate further or consider a different candidate move.
7. Don't Be Afraid to Start Over
If you find yourself stuck, don't be afraid to start over and re-evaluate the position. Sometimes a fresh perspective is all you need to find the solution.
Practical Tips for Effective Practice
Consistent practice is key to improving your chess problem-solving skills. Here are some practical tips to help you get the most out of your practice sessions:
1. Set Aside Dedicated Time for Practice
Schedule regular practice sessions in your calendar and treat them as important appointments. Even short, focused sessions can be highly effective.
2. Start with Easier Problems
Begin with problems that are slightly below your current skill level to build confidence and reinforce basic concepts. As you improve, gradually increase the difficulty.
3. Focus on Quality Over Quantity
It's better to solve a few problems carefully and thoroughly than to rush through many problems without fully understanding them. Take the time to analyze each position and calculate the variations.
4. Use a Variety of Resources
There are many excellent resources available for chess problem solving, including books, websites, and apps. Experiment with different resources to find the ones that work best for you.
5. Analyze Your Mistakes
When you get a problem wrong, take the time to understand why you made the mistake. Did you overlook a key tactical idea? Did you miscalculate a variation? Learning from your mistakes is crucial for improvement.
6. Track Your Progress
Keep track of your progress over time. This will help you stay motivated and see how far you've come.
7. Consider Different Time Controls
Some chess problem websites will offer different time controls (e.g., blitz, rapid, or untimed). Experiment with these and see which mode works best for your learning style.
Recommended Resources for Chess Problem Solving
Here are some highly recommended resources for honing your chess problem-solving skills:
Websites
- Lichess (lichess.org): A free and open-source chess platform with a vast collection of puzzles, ranging from beginner to advanced levels. Lichess also offers a variety of training features, such as puzzle streak and puzzle racer.
- Chess.com: A popular chess website with a large library of puzzles, as well as lessons, articles, and videos. Chess.com offers both free and premium memberships.
- ChessTempo (chesstempo.com): A dedicated chess training website with a focus on tactics training. ChessTempo offers a sophisticated algorithm that adapts the difficulty of the puzzles to your skill level.
- Chesspuzzle.net: Another website dedicated to chess problems, with a clean interface and a wide range of puzzles to choose from.
Books
- "Chess Tactics from Scratch" by Martin Weteschnik: A great book for beginners that introduces the basic tactical motifs in chess.
- "1001 Chess Exercises for Beginners" by Franco Masetti: A comprehensive collection of puzzles for beginners to practice their tactical skills.
- "Improve Your Chess Tactics: 700 Practical Lessons & Exercises" by Yasser Seirawan: A more advanced book that covers a wide range of tactical themes and ideas.
- "Logical Chess: Move By Move" by Irving Chernev: While not strictly a puzzle book, this book presents annotated games with clear explanations of the strategic and tactical ideas involved.
Apps
- Chess.com app: Mobile app version of the Chess.com website, with access to their puzzle library and other training features.
- Lichess app: Mobile app version of the Lichess website.
- Tactica: Chess Puzzles: A dedicated app for chess puzzles, with a user-friendly interface and a wide range of puzzles to choose from.
Adapting Problem Solving to Real Games
While solving chess problems is a great way to improve your tactical and strategic vision, it's important to remember that real games are often more complex and dynamic than puzzles. Here are some tips for adapting your problem-solving skills to real games:
1. Take Your Time
In a real game, you have more time to think than you do in a puzzle. Use that time wisely to carefully analyze the position and consider all your options.
2. Be Aware of Your Opponent's Plans
In a puzzle, you know that there is a solution. In a real game, you need to be aware of your opponent's plans and try to anticipate their moves. Don't get so focused on your own attack that you neglect your defense.
3. Don't Be Afraid to Deviate from Your Plan
Sometimes, the best plan is to deviate from your original plan. If your opponent makes an unexpected move, be prepared to adjust your strategy accordingly.
4. Trust Your Intuition
After solving many chess problems, your intuition will become sharper. Trust your intuition, but always double-check your calculations.
5. Learn from Your Games
After each game, take the time to analyze your mistakes. What could you have done differently? What tactical or strategic ideas did you miss? Learning from your games is crucial for improvement.
